## Deploying the Gatewick Proctor Queue

Deploys are pretty painless: push to main, wait for the pipeline, then watch the queue drain dashboard for five minutes. If candidates pile up mid-exam, roll back first and ask questions later — the queue replays safely. Everything the workers care about lives in one config block, shown here for reference.

settings of bafof-yagef:
JOROX_PIN=8740
JOROX_TENANT=pelox
JOROX_METRICS_HOST=metrics.jorox.qorvelworks.internal
JOROX_SEAL=seal_c78f63c1
JOROX_STANDBY_TEAM=norax

Subject: On-call handover — Bramblegate health checks

Hey — quick handover note. The Bramblegate load balancer flagged two app nodes as unhealthy overnight; turned out the /healthz endpoint times out during the nightly cache warm. I bumped the check timeout to 10s as a stopgap. Keep an eye on it around 02:00. Full notes are in the runbook. If anything flares up, reach the infra rotation at the address below.

escalation mailbox, bafog-fafog: ulador@paliqlabs.internal

Subject: DR drill — date localization fallback

Team,

Thursday's disaster-recovery drill will simulate loss of the Calverton locale service, which formats dates for the Tidemark dashboard. During the drill, tickets may show ISO dates instead of regional formats — this is expected, so please don't escalate. The failover runbook sits in the sealed support binder. To decrypt the binder copy during the drill, use the passphrase below.

recovery phrase for tagug-yagug: lamox-gilax-keleth-gilath